Jim Carrey played The Riddler in Joel Schumacher’s 1995 Batman Forever movie, and now the actor says he wouldn’t mind having another role in the new Batman films.
Speaking with THR, Carrey says, “I’d love to work in the new graphic-novel versions of the movie.”
Carrey continues with mention he would like to work with Christopher Nolan, who is on board Batman Vs. Superman as a producer. And how about playing The Riddler again?
“I don’t know about reprising the role,” Carrey said. “I don’t think Chris Nolan would go for that, but I’d love to work with him.”
Jim Carrey was actually at one point due to work with Nolan on a film about Howard Hughes; however, it was scrapped due to Martin Scorsese‘s The Aviator, which came out around the same time.
